History of Gas Recreation F.C
03 Sep 2006

First formed in 1937, the team were called The Colchester Gas Light And Coke Company F.C then they broke for the war and reformed in 1952,calling themselves Eastern Gas and entering the Colchester and East Essex League.
In 1955 they moved to there own ground in Whitehall Road,Colchester. In 1963 under the management of Gerald Greenleaf,they gained membership to the Essex & Suffolk Border League (Division One). Four years later Colchester Borough Council bought the ground and offered Bromley Road in exchange.The Gas Board then built a Sports Ground there and that is where Gas Recreation have played this present day.the name GasRecreation came from the amalgamation of the Gas Board's team with Recreation Athletic.In 1969 they won promotion to the premier division as champions of Division One.Gas went on to win the Premier Division in 1971/72 and allso finnished as runners up in the Essex Intermediate Cup that year,losing to Pegasus in the Final.The next notable run of success was in 1995/96 under the management of a young and passionate Mick Potter (who is now a legend at the club),winning the Premier Division of the Essex & Suffolk Border League four times in a row and finnishing runners up in 1999/2000.Included in this run of success was a runners up spot in the League Knockout Cup in 1994/95 and winning the same competition for the following three seasons.The ultimate achievement of winning the Essex Intermediate Cup came in 1996/97, beating Danbury Trafford in the final.That same year Gas Recreation achieved a unique treble by winning the Essex Intermediate Cup,the Border League and the League Knockout Cup.In 2000 Mick Potter sadly left to take over as Mamager of Clacton Town.Richard Elmes and Tony Davis took over and in there second year in charge in 2001/2002 they won the Essex Intermediate Cup beating Harold Wood Two-Nil at Heybridge Swifts.In 2004/05 Richard with the help of Ian Phillips won the Premier Division of the Border League by a record 16 points.In 2005-2006 Richard and Ian done the double winning the premier league and the knock out cup
